The Aquatics Manager is responsible for overseeing the daily operation of all water attractions and aquatic areas, ensuring compliance with established safety and operational standards. This role leads the development and execution of training programs, with a strong focus on safety, guest satisfaction, and team member engagement.

Responsibilities

  • Daily management of all park operations and water attractions in compliance with established operational and safety standards.
  • Responsible for training programs and operations, ensuring that safety, quality, employee engagement and guest courtesy are paramount.
  • Responsible for implementation and oversight of all water safety programs for guests and ambassadors, to include lifeguard audits as conducted by the American Red Cross, and SEA
  • Proactively manage the guest experience to ensure all guest concerns are prevented and/or resolved in a timely manner.
  • Responsible for managing inventory, ordering, and park setup of furniture, supplies, and equipment for the Aquatics Department. This includes, but is not limited to, life vests (PFDs), tubes, rescue equipment, water park furniture, and ride vehicles.
